I have often read about the value provided by publishers in both the editing and review of academic articles. But it may be that these aren't actually core to the publication industry. "Some scholarly publishers have already outsourced operations like copy editing and printing. Now, 15 journals are outsourcing something central to science itself: the peer-review process." They will instead accept without further review articles offered by a non-profit "peer community" organization. So what is core to publishers? Well, subscriptions, of course.
